#d330ae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#d330ae is composed of 82.7% red, 18.8% green and 68.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 77.3% magenta, 17.5% yellow and 17.3% black. It has a hue angle of 313.6 degrees, a saturation of 64.9% and a lightness of 50.8%. #d330ae color hex could be obtained by blending #ff60ff with #a7005d. Closest websafe color is: #cc3399.

Shades and Tints of #d330ae

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030103 is the darkest color, while #fcf2fa is the lightest one.
